What Are Refractometer Microscopes? Ernst Abbe invented the refractometer microscope in 1869, and it is often called the Abbe refractometer. It looked like a regular microscope, but the device uses two prisms: one light-reflecting and the other refracting. The item being evaluated is placed between these two prisms.
